Media Coverage

Film Festival Honors

Toe the Line: Arts Education for Life is an Official Selection of the LA Dance Film Festival and won an Award of Merit in the Impact Docs Awards competition.

Steps in Time: Worcester Daily Newspaper Profiles Toe the Line

Documentary Spotlights Longtime Burncoat Dance Teacher Joan Sheary and Students: The Worcester Telegram & Gazette published a lengthy profile of Toe the Line, including interviews with Joan and students featured in the documentary.
